British Trust for Conservation Volunteers manages environmental conservation projects, which inspire people into improving places. In doing so BTCV ensure the volunteers develop an understanding of their self worth as they become involved in community projects and included within the project teams.
John Laing are committed to supporting BTCV's activities with young people. BTCV's youth programmes provide opportunities that encompass community service and environmental benefit, coupled with education, training and personal development.
Through the Charitable Trust, John Laing has agreed to fund six BTCV Green Gym Conversions in areas local to our projects or investments.
These conversions operate by upgrading existing conservation and environmental community groups to formal Green Gyms, which link to the local health care trusts. The purpose of Green Gyms is to encourage individuals with physical or mental health issues to undertake physical work outdoors, thus improving their overall wellbeing whilst contributing towards environmental enhancement. This creates a sustainable approach, offering benefits to both the local community and the surrounding natural resources.
